Magaldi is constructing its cash budget. Its budgeted monthly sales are $20,000, and they are constant from month to month. 60%
iogann1982 [59]

Answer:

$5,820

Step-by-step explanation:

The average net cash flow during the month is total cash receipt minus total payments.

Cash receipt on the month's sales=60%*$20,000*98.5%=$11820

60% cash received ,the 98.5% is after cash discount of 1.5%

cash receipt from previous month sale=40%*$20,000=$8,000

Payment for purchases=$20,000*40%=$8,000

payment for wages,rent and taxes=$20,000*30%=$6000

Total cash inflow=$11,820+$8,000=$19820

total cash outflow=$8,000+$6,000=$14,000

average net cash flow=$19,820-$14,000=$5,820
